In order to protect the world, they would have to save the one who would bring about its destruction;
Only problem is he doesn’t want any part of it.

Meet a reluctant avatar- a bringer of annihilation and cleanser of all life- and those who intend to rescue him from destiny itself. Joining him is a talented young mage far from her homeland, a well-respected warrior and a scholar who isn’t quite what one would expect.

Deities, dragons, sword fights, rival sects and powerful magic- join the journey across Demaria’s remarkable lands!

Sometimes the only way to rid oneself of the past…
is to go back and confront it.

I don't know where to start. It was a good book. The magic and fighting was good, didn't see any typos and if I did, I was so into the book I didn't care. I was just really confused about the world they inhabit. I know its hard to explain when you're writing, especially if you want to keep people entertained, but I needed some type of info. That was the only thing I didn't like. Great book. Hopefully not the end cause seriously, that had me going, what? That's it! There's got to be more.
